Colombian singer Maluma announced this Tuesday that, after a year, she absence from concertsstarting next August 31st, he will once again present himself in 30 cities in the United States with the show “Don Juan World Tour”.
“I’m excited to be back on stage in… NOW this fall. I took a year to focus on perfecting what I consider the best album of my career, ‘Don Juan,'” Maluma said in a press release.
The singer also claimed that he is eager to introduce him to his the first followers of the songs of the new albumwhich will also be accompanied by his greatest hits in what the artist believes “will be the most ambitious concert production to date”.
Maluma will begin his stage August 31 in town Sacrament (California) and will conclude it November 4 in the city of Miami (Florida).
The Colombian “promises to surprise thousands of fans” with his hits like “Hawaii”, “Felices los Cuatro”, “Sobrio” and his latest song “Diablo, que chimba” with Puerto Rican singer Anuel AA.
